| Thecus N7700 Pro v1 Failed NAS RAID 6 7x2Tb-Disk Data Recovery |
|
Posted by: Enquiries - 05-22-2023, 02:00 PM - Forum: Before you buy Q&A
- Replies (1)
|
 |
Hi, I'm wondering if you might be able to help.
A Thecus N7700 Pro v1 that has been running without issue (firmware version 5.03.02) for the past 13 years has recently failed. Upon reboot the unit gets stuck at the Self Testing ... stage based upon the orange status LED.
Thecus support want $200 to raise a support ticket - pointless as the unit is no longer accessible over any network. It could either be that the on-board double NIC has failed or the dual DOM itself.
As the unit has no video output socket troubleshooting the issue is problematic to say the least. What I haven't been able to ascertain is what specific hardware that is needed to allow the drives to all be mounted on another PC and how to image the drives and use the images to recover the data.
Any advise would be greatly appreciated.
